Just to clarify, but does UAPP use the full technical capability of the Fiio X5 3rd Gen? Just wondering. I have it on the player beside the base app and Hiby.
The only DAP that allows 3rd party apps to use full technical capability is iBasso DX200. For both UAPP and Hiby it includes Native DSD playback, and, of course, bit perfect PCM formats for up to 32/384. With any other DAP, only manufacturer's software may take the full advantage of the hardware.
